Position Overview:

We are currently seeking a skilled and motivated Residential HVAC Installer to join our team in Vancouver, WA. The ideal candidate will have a strong background in HVAC systems, a passion for problem-solving, and a commitment to delivering top-notch service to our valued customers.

Responsibilities: Installation projects for residential HVAC systems, ensuring adherence to safety protocols and quality standards. Collaborate with the installation team to assign tasks, oversee work progress, and ensure efficient project completion. Install, maintain, troubleshoot, and repair heating, cooling, and ventilation systems. Interact with clients in a professional manner, addressing their questions and concerns, and providing solutions that meet their needs. Keep accurate records of work performed, materials used, and time spent for each project. Stay up-to-date with industry trends, new technologies, and best practices in HVAC installation and service.

Qualifications: Minimum of 1 year of experience as a Residential HVAC Installer with a proven track record in installations. Strong knowledge of HVAC systems, components, and electrical circuits. Excellent leadership skills with the ability to guide and motivate a team effectively. Valid HVAC technician certification and relevant licenses as required by the state of Washington. Proficient in reading and interpreting blueprints, schematics, and technical manuals. Exceptional problem-solving abilities and a commitment to delivering high-quality workmanship. Excellent communication and customer service skills.
